you want info about how i made the catapult, don't you? (this is a real question... i don't understand well the english)

well. i made the catapult in wings3d. then export it to .obj in several pieces.
the handle was an independet object.
then i put all the pieces in a bone layer. i made two bones in front, to give the sensation of irregular ground when it moves.
i made another bone layer and i put inside the handle layer. then i put this bone layer inside the first bone layer.
in the second layer, i put a bone to move the handle (to do this, i first had to turn the handle 90º in z, because if i didn't made this, the bone would be useless).
wheel are moved in cycles.

to make the catapult come from behind the hill, i made a mask.
i also made this to put the ladybugs inside the basket.
